SEDGWICK COUNTY —Law enforcement authorities are investigating three suspects in connection with a report of shots fire near the Maize Airport,  an unincorporated area of Sedgwick County.

Just before 9:30 a.m. Friday, Sedgwick County Emergency Communications received a call reporting an active shooter at the Maize Airport located at 8001 W 45th Street North,  according to Lt. Benjamin Blick. 

The caller reported two suspects at the airport and another suspect leaving in a vehicle. The caller also provided a description of the vehicle including the registration plate number.

Deputies and officers from several agencies responded to the airport and located a 49-year-old man and  35-year-old Yancy Hermosillo near the area where the shooting allegedly occurred.

Both men were detained. During a search of the area for casualties, spent shell casings and firearms were observed, but no victims or evidence of injury was found. The vehicle reported to have left the scene was located in southeast Wichita occupied by a 27-year-old man.

After questioning, the 49 and 27-year-old were released. Hermosillo was arrested for an outstanding federal warrant for drug and weapons violations.

During the investigation detectives determined, the shots fired at the airport were not reckless or unauthorized and did not support the elements of a crime.
